Output 75e0b16c2b9e1b157228787a33a14d6885a34e1d4233e8abe55857e9e83336fd:1

value
991558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83203cf6598698bf538e5717e507c869b9bfd2df OP_EQUAL
address
3DeM4cpQhFBm8ohTeXzA3VUZU7RRvWe3kA
transaction
75e0b16c2b9e1b157228787a33a14d6885a34e1d4233e8abe55857e9e83336fd
spent
true